Shortcut Management

Enable users to add shortcuts to Siri, and have your app suggest shortcuts to users.

Topics

Essentials

Suggesting Shortcuts to Users

Make suggestions for shortcuts the user may want to add to Siri.

Manage Shortcuts

INVoiceShortcutCenter

Retrieve the user's shortcuts and make shortcut suggestions.

INVoiceShortcut

A shortcut the user added to Siri.

Shortcut Button

INUIAddVoiceShortcutButton

A button that allows the user to add or edit a shortcut.

Shortcut Editors

INUIAddVoiceShortcutViewController

A view controller that guides the user through the steps for adding a shortcut to Siri.

INUIEditVoiceShortcutViewController

A view controller that lets the user edit or remove an existing shortcut.

See Also

Shortcuts

Adding User Interactivity with Siri Shortcuts and the Shortcuts App

Add custom intents and parameters to help users interact more quickly and effectively with Siri and the Shortcuts app.

Donating Shortcuts

Tell Siri about shortcuts to actions that the user performed in your app.

Deleting Donated Shortcuts

Remove your donations from Siri.

Soup Chef: Accelerating App Interactions with Shortcuts

Make it easy for people to use Siri with your app by providing shortcuts to your app’s actions.

Relevant Shortcuts

Display shortcuts on the Siri watch face.

INShortcut

An object representing an action available in your app that the system may suggest to a user or a user may add to Siri.

INObject

An object that represents a custom intent parameter.